SICT and CONAGUA report on controlled water leakage / @jorgenunol @SICTmx >>>

#SICT.- Regarding the rupture of a pipeline of the Los Reyes-Ferrocarril Branch, the National Water Commission (Conagua) informs that the leak was controlled at 21:50 hours, by personnel of the Secretariat of Infrastructure, Communications and Transportation (SICT) and this Commission.
The leak occurred while the SICT was carrying out work to change the routing of a pipe for the construction of a pedestrian bridge. This required modifying the location of a 10-inch diameter line that connects well 3 to the Los Reyes-Railroad Branch. During this maneuver, a coupling joint was moved, which caused the runoff.

It is important to note that this infrastructure does not form part of or affect the Cutzamala System.
The brigades of Infrastructure Protection and Emergency Attention (PIAE) deployed specialized personnel and equipment to collaborate in the work of removing the water and mitigating the effects on the population.
Three Vactor trucks from Tultitlán, Tlalnepantla and the Water Commission of the State of Mexico (CAEM) also provided support.
